- Abstract: This paper shows how to apply frequency-domain system identification of the parameters of a linear system based on both one-bit stimulation and data acquisition. The proposed technique is based on the usage of maximum-length binary sequences as signal sources. One-bit acquisition, based on a simple comparator is assisted by a sinewave dither signal. Results are compared to those obtained by directly processing the one-bit sequence in absence of dither. Theoretical, simulation and experimental results illustrate the usage of the method and confirm the validity of the presented procedure.
